Show diff dialog for one unit testing
2011041206552197.png

This screenshot shows diff dialog after one unit test performed. In this dialog you can compare target result set and reference result set in the set-style or sequential-style.


Show set-style comparison result for one unit testing
2011041206560832.png

This screenshot shows all changed parts between target result set and reference result set in the set-style.
